Energise bank balance with a utilities refund

MILLIONS of households could be sitting on hundreds of pounds in unused energy credit however most won't ask for it back.
A staggering 15 million homes have a combined £3 billion in credit with their suppliers, an average of around £200 each, according to new research from comparison site Uswitch.
Yet only one in three households plan to request a refund, despite the ongoing cost-of-living crisis squeezing incomes.
At this time of year, most energy credit should have been used up by winter bills. But many are still sitting on large sums, often without realising it. One in 10 is owed more than £300, and 4% owed over £500.
Elise Melville, energy expert at Uswitch.com, said: “During the energy crisis, we advised households to leave credit with their supplier to protect against soaring prices. But consumers with excessive credit should consider reclaiming it now.”
